In-District Tuition

The tuition for in-district Kansas residents (local residents) attending Independence Community College is $4,560 per academic year. Room and board fees total $7,200. Additionally, books and supplies typically cost $816 plus the school charges $2,340 in other fees. In total, students should budget for an annual total cost of $18,116 to attend Independence Community College.

Housing Costs

On campus room and board is provided by the school at a cost of $7,200 per academic year. Students electing to live off campus elsewhere in Independence should budget at least this amount.

Books and Supplies

The estimated annual cost for books and educational supplies is $816.

Other Living Expenses

If living on-campus, students should budget for $3,200 in additional living expenses. Off-campus students should budget for $3,000 in other miscellaneous living expenses.

Net Price

The average reported annual net price for Independence Community College for students receiving grants or scholarship aid was $3,738* in 2023/2024. Net price includes tuition and required fees, books and supplies, and average cost for room and board and other expenses.

Average Net Price 2023/2024

$3,738

Financial Aid

90% of full-time undergrad Independence Community College received financial aid in the form of grants, scholarships, fellowships from the institution or from Federal, State or local government agencies. This aid averaged $7,549 per student during the 2023/2024 school year. Grant and scholarship aid does not need to be paid back.

Pell Grants

62 percent of students received aid in the form of Pell Grants from the U.S. Federal Government. The average Pell Grant awarded for 2023/2024 was $6,472. To apply for a Pell Grant to attend Independence Community College, the first step is to fill out the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A).

Student Loans

26% of students received Federal Student Loans averaging $4,021.

Student Loans

To gauge a more realistic picture of what it really could cost you out of pocket to go to Independence Community College, we've modeled a ten year student loan with an original principal value of $7,476. The loan balance of $7,476 is a two year multiple of the $3,738 average net price. This is a estimate of what you could owe upon graduation if you were to qualify for average financial aid and what a degree really may cost. Should you not qualify for financial aid, you may owe significantly more when you graduate. Based on these assumptions, a monthly repayment of $85 could be required to pay off your student loan. The total of all payments including interest would sum $10,195.75.

Please note that financial aid is not guaranteed and is only available for qualifying students. Federal Student Loans are not grants and must be repaid with interest. The current Stafford loan interest rate is 6.52%.
